-1
votes

Xcode 12, iOS 14, Pods

Après avoir mis à jour l'iPhone à iOS 14, Xcode 11.5 a cessé de lancer des projets de lancement sur l'iPhone, j'ai décidé de mettre à niveau Xcode vers la version 12 et a obtenu un grand nombre d'erreurs liées aux pods pour 60 d'entre eux ... essentiellement, tout est lié au fait que les citations ne peuvent pas être utilisées dans des pods et doivent utiliser <> pour connecter des bibliothèques. Lorsque je corrigez-le avec <>, je reçois des erreurs que j'ai besoin d'utiliser "", mais c'est tout avertissement, à savoir une erreur en raison du fait que Xcode a cessé de voir une bibliothèque. À l'écran toutes les informations.

 Entrez la description de l'image ici Merci d'avance pour votre aide)

Comment le réparer?


1 commentaires

IOS 14 et les outils associés sont en version bêta maintenant et venaient de libérer plus tôt cette semaine; La plupart des bibliothèques ne seront pas mises à jour pour les soutenir. Cela devrait toujours être votre attente avec le logiciel bêta.


3 Réponses :


3
votes

J'ai eu un problème similaire et j'ai corrigé en modifiant la cible de déploiement de tous les gousses. La plupart des gousses ciblaient IOS 8.0, ce qui n'est plus supporté par Xcode 12.


0 commentaires

1
votes

Assurez-vous de disposer de la même version de votre citation de déploiement et de la plate-forme Podfile

  1. N'ouvrez pas votre projet en Xcode 12 après la mise à jour Xcode

  2. Ouvrez votre podfile de projet à travers le terminal

  3. Enlevez tout simplement toutes vos libérations lib et do Pod Installer (supprimez également ce type de code de code supplémentaire si vous avez écrit quelque chose en ce qui concerne l'architecture de 86 ou 64 que nous avons écrite pour supprimer les avertissements)

  4. Données dérivées claires par chemin sans ouverture Xcode (~ / Bibliothèque / Développeur / XCode / DeriveData)

  5. Après avoir supprimé toute liber toute autre lib liber et que la pod est installée

  6. Ouvrez votre projet et définissez le système de construction sur le nouveau système de construction (par défaut) dans les paramètres de l'espace de travail partagé et utilisez le paramètre partagé dans le système de construction dans les paramètres de l'espace de travail pré-utilisateur (vous pouvez trouver ces paramètres pendant que Xcode est sélectionné dans le menu Fichier et cliquez sur Paramètres de l'espace de travail)

  7. Nettoyez et construisez puis exécutez-le, vous ne trouverez pas de choses concernant le module non trouvé, vous ferez affronter certaines mises à jour de la syntaxe ou aucune mises à jour libérez-les et optez pour courir


0 commentaires

0
votes

Essayez d'installer une machine à nouveau, supprimez tout pod et installez à nouveau.

sudo rm -fr ~/Library/Caches/CocoaPods/
pod install


0 commentaires